This German angora DK yarn is spun from the short-hair angora fiber with a small content of lambswool for strength. With wear and use, it develops a soft and fluffy 'halo'. Elsness DK is very well hand-dyed in good solid hues. Put-ups: 25g, Natural White in 25 and 15g balls. Elsness DK is suitable for any kinds of garments, including accessories such as scarves, hats, shrugs, gloves, baby knits, medicinal and athletic warmers.

FIBRE: 80% German Angora, 20% Lambswool
YARN WEIGHT: Double Knit
TENSION: 10x10 cm (4"): 20 sts / 26 rows
NEEDLES: 3.5 - 4 mm (US № 4-6)
BALL WEIGHT: 25g and 15g
LENGTH: 25g: approx. 100m /109 yds, 15g: 65m /71 yds

ATHLETIC WRIST WARMERS | Posted Feb 14, 2017. One size (S-M-L): 1 x 25g ball, 3.5 mm (US4) needles, crochet hook 3.5 mm (US-E), a small strand of wool or alpaca yarn in same colour. Cast on 46 sts, right side: 1 edge sts, *4K, 4P*, rep *, 1 edge sts. 2nd row: 1 edge sts, *4P, 4K*, rep *, 1 edge sts. Continue, until piece measures 15 cm (6"). Cast off all sts. Fold in half facing the wrong side, and using a strand of wool or alpaca in the same or similar colour and crochet hook, join sides on one end, making an edge of approx 3 cm (1-1/4"), then join sides on the second end, making an edge of approx 7 cm (2-3/4"). Turn inside out.

Garment Care: Hand wash with mild soap in lukewarm water, lay flat to dry, avoiding exposure to direct sunlight.
No iron.
